Its a fair question, boiling down to "why did windows 8 have such a weird start menu and why did it go away, not continuing to win10?" And one answer would be "Touchscreens and Windows didn't turn out to be as big as anticipated so a big-button interface wasn't really needed, and mobile OSs were used in most touch-based devices, not Windows"
